Re: PCMs
« Reply #3 on: Dec 26, 2018, 10:33 »
Are you looking to purchase a PCM or a portal monitor?


your previous questions on these forums have all had to do with rather dated equipment,....


the Argos is a good machine, but if you are considering an equivalent replacement to the Eberline PM-7s which you discussed on these forums once upon a time ago, you're way off of that field of play with the Argos AB series,....


and they cost a lot, and the routine support and maintenance are a lot in comparison to other players, and with only one machine in service there will be no economy of scale for your facility,...


quite the opposite,...


the economy of scale is pert much the raison d'être for investing in a bank of Argos equipment,...
